Whatareinsects(昆虫)likeinyoureyes?Haveyouevernoticedthem?Insectsareveryinterestinganimals.Theymaybesmall,buttheyaresmartandhard-working.Scientistshavestudieddifferentkindsofinsectsveryclosely.Accordingtotheirstudies,eventhesmallestinsectshavetoolstohelpdotheirwork.
Haveyoueverseenalittleflycalledasawfly?Itgetssuchanamebecauseithasasaw(锯子)thatisusedonplantstocreateasafespaceforitseggs.Afterlayingitseggs,thesawflymakessomeglue.Thegluefixestheeggstowheretheyarelaid.
Anotherinsectthathasitsownnaturaltoolisthepoppybee.Thebeesliveinwood.Likepeoplewhomakethingsoutofwood,poppybeesusespecialtoolstodignests(巢穴)outofwood.Theydigandcleanoutthenesttomakeitreadyforuse.Whenallisready,poppybeescutoutpiecesofleavesintheshapeofanest.Theythenjointhepiecestogetherandputthemintothenest.
Antsarealsoknownfortheircleveruseofnaturaltools.Forexample,theydroppiecesofleavesintowatersothattheytakeinthewater.Thentheantscarrythembacktotheirnests.Therearemoreinsectsthananyotherlivingthingsintheworld.Everyinsectisspecial.Themoreyounoticethem,themoretheywillsurpriseyou.29.Howdoesthewriterstartthetopic?______A.Bylistingnumbers. Recently,manypeopleinChinahavestartedamovementcalled"readingrehabilitation"(康复).Thismeanstrainingthebraintoreadlongbooksagain.Intheageofshortvideosandsocialmedia,manypeoplefindithardtofocusonmorethanafewsentences.Arecentreportshowsthatadultsspendoverthreehoursadayontheirphones,butonlythirtyminutesreadingrealbooks.Thisischangingthewayweuseourmindsandhowwetalktooneanotherinpublic.
Expertsbelievethatifwekeepscrolling(滚动)thescreen,ourbrainswilllookforquickexcitement.Thismakeslong-formreadingseemdifficultandboring.However,whenwestopreadingdeeply,ourthinkingbecomesshallow.Insteadoflookingatallsidesofaproblem,peopleoftenmakequick,emotional(情绪化的)judgments.Thiscanleadtosimpleandunfairideasinsociety.Tofightthis,manyarenow"rehabilitating"theirmindsbystartingwitheasybooksorreadingjusttenpagesaday.Theywanttoregainthepatienceneededtounderstandcomplexideas.
Tosupportthis,theChinesegovernmenthasintroducednewrulestopromotereadingacrossthecountry.ThereisevenaspecialnationalreadingweekeveryApriltoencourageeveryonetopickupabook.Relearninghowtoreadismorethanjustahobby.Itisawaytoprotectourabilitytothinkclearly.Byslowingdownandfinishingabook,wecanhavebetterdiscussionsandbuildasmarter,morethoughtfulsocietyforthefuture.33.Whatdoestherecentreportshowaboutadults?______A.Theyfinditeasytofocusonlongsentences.

BanChaowasafamousgeneraloftheEasternHanDynasty(25A.D.-220A.D.).Heonceled36mentotheStateofShanshan(鄯善)toexpresstheHan'swishtobuildfriendlytieswiththestate.Atfirst,theKingofShanshanwasfriendlytothem,butsuddenly,withnoclearreason,hebegantotreatthemcoldly.
Infact,theHuns(匈奴)hadalsosentmessengerstoShanshaninordertocausetroublebetweentheHanandShanshan.Facingbothsides,theKingofShanshanbegantofeelunsure.
WhenBanChaorealizedwhatwashappening,hegatheredhismenandsaid,"Weareingreatdangernow.Ifthingsgoonlikethis,ShanshanmightcatchusandhandusovertotheHuns.Thenwewon'tbeabletocompleteourmission,andwewilldie!"
"Whatshouldwedonow?"themenasked."We'llfollowyourorder!"
BanChaosaid,"Youcan'tcatchatiger'scubunlessyouenteritsden.Wemusttakeaction.Let'skilltheHuns'messengerstonight!"
Thatnight,BanChaoledasuddenattackontheHuns'camp.Afterahardfight,thegeneralandhis36menkilledmorethan100oftheHuns.
Thenextday,BanChaomettheKingofShanshanandtoldhimabouttheevent.AssoonastheKingheardthis,hewasimpressedbytheirbravery.Headmiredthem,butatthesametime,hefeltafraidofthem.HethensignedapeaceagreementwiththeHan.
